EJGH First In Region For American College of Radiology

ASTRO designation signifies higher quality of care for radiology oncology program. Jefferson Radiation Oncology at East Jefferson General Hospital is the first facility in the region to earn the ASTRO accreditation from the American College of Radiology (ACR). Prostate Cancer Treatment Records Show 95% Cure Rating

Dr. Paul Monsour presents data at ASCO Genitourinary Cancers Symposium This informational graphic from Dr. Paul Monsour’s presentation at The American Society of Clinical Oncology’s (ASCO) Genitourinary Cancers Symposium in March 2015 shows prostate cancer cases treated using brachytherapy at East Jefferson General Hospital.
